Emma is a novel about the dangers of misinterpreted romance. The main character, Emma Woodhouse, is described in the opening paragraph as “handsome, clever, and rich.” The novel charts Emma’s gradual realization of her own lack of self-knowledge. It centers upon her determination to arrange her life and the lives of those around her into a pattern dictated by her romantic fancy. Along the way, there is much of heartbreak, romance and detailed, subtle character representation. Emma is often seen as a wonderful depiction of the workings of a well-meaning but ill-directed mind wishing to act selflessly. |
